Abstract

The invention provides a detecting method of a refrigerator. The refrigerator comprises a plurality of loads. The detecting method comprises the following steps of: judging whether the refrigerator enters a detecting mode; if the refrigerator enters the detecting mode, carrying out switch testing on the loads; after the switch testing is finished, carrying out refrigeration testing on the refrigerator; and generating a performance detecting result of the refrigerator according to a switch testing result and a refrigeration testing result. The detecting method provided by the invention has the advantages of high detecting efficiency, standard detecting flow, objective and accurate detecting result and convenience in popularization, and has good transportability.

Background technology
Refrigerator comprises mechanical temperature control refrigerator and computer temperature control refrigerator (abbreviation electric control refrigerator).Wherein, most of electric control refrigerators all have cold, the quick-frozen of speed, automatic defrosting, the function such as anti-condensation, variation along with refrigerator functions, level of integrated system is also more complicated, some refrigerator only when reaching specified conditions, could start operation with automatic ice maker, human body induction module, many load circuits.In batch production, increased difficulty for check, detection.
At present, the batch production line detecting method has sampling observation, and test item is less, for example detects power consumption and the refrigerating capacity of refrigerator.Yet the specific loads loop is detected and is difficult to judge (such as automatic defrosting loop, ice making control loop), and individual the detection needs to sample, and usually need human intervention, detection method is single, and effect is low, brings very large hidden danger for the end product quality of manufacturing enterprise.
The following problem that the detection method of existing refrigerator exists in practical operation:
1, because the refrigeration for refrigerator cycle is longer, and the operations such as refrigeration control, defrosting control, ice making control need to be satisfied specified conditions and could move.Verify one by one whether each control loop duty is normal, need to expend a lot of times, and detection efficiency is low.
2, the refrigerator of each model is variant at aspects such as functional configuration and refrigeration systems, and detection scheme and standard disunity are unfavorable for detecting and checking and accepting.
3, in traditional detection method, the factor that artificial perception is judged is too much, and it is more artificially to participate in program.Unfavorable to large-scale production, and do not have standard qualitative, that quantize.

Below in conjunction with the detection method of accompanying drawing description according to the refrigerator of the embodiment of the invention.
As shown in Figure 1, the detection method according to the refrigerator of the embodiment of the invention may further comprise the steps:
Step S101 judges whether refrigerator enters detecting pattern.
In an embodiment of the present invention, judge that the step whether refrigerator enters detecting pattern comprises: judge whether refrigerator satisfies testing conditions; If refrigerator satisfies testing conditions, then refrigerator enters detecting pattern after receiving the detection instruction.Particularly, when satisfying testing conditions, after user's detection trigger switch and duration surpass Preset Time, send and detect instruction.For example, within one minute that refrigerator is begun to switch on, refrigerator satisfies testing conditions, within begin to switch at refrigerator one minute, behind testing staff or user's detection trigger switch, send and detect instruction to refrigerator, for example will detect the controller that refrigeration sends to refrigerator, like this, controller control refrigerator enters detecting pattern.In this example, detector switch can be realized by the mode of Macintosh, after for example two or more buttons in the guidance panel of refrigerator are pressed simultaneously and the duration reached 5 seconds, send and detect instruction to controller, mode by combination button, have and avoid in the normal use procedure of refrigerator, user misoperation makes refrigerator enter the advantage of detecting pattern.
Step S102 if refrigerator enters detecting pattern, then carries out switch testing to a plurality of loads.
In an embodiment of the present invention, a plurality of loads include but not limited to: defrosting heater, bar desk heater strip, strong point illuminating lamp and bactericidal lamp.The step of in this example, switch testing is carried out in a plurality of loads comprises: with preset order switch testing is carried out in a plurality of loads.For example, successively to defrosting heater, bar desk heater strip, strong point illuminating lamp, bactericidal lamp starts and close test (switch testing).Wherein, above-mentioned preset order only for exemplary purposes, preset order can be carried out according to actual needs order and be adjusted.
Further, the switch periods of switch testing is but is not limited to 2-4 second, and the duty ratio of time of opening and closing is 3:1.The switch periods of supposing switch testing is 2 seconds, wherein, opens 1.5 seconds, closes 0.5 second, and whether a plurality of loads (load circuit) that can detect thus refrigerator are unusual.
Step S103 is after switch testing is finished, to the refrigerator test of freezing.
Particularly, the switch testing time can be made as 2-5 minute, and after all loads had been carried out switch testing with preset order, refrigerator entered the refrigeration test.The for example valve of refrigerator or air door action, compressor start, successively reefer, refrigerating chamber, temperature-changing chamber are carried out a period of time refrigeration, for example will be made as 10 minutes to the cooling time of the refrigeration of each chamber test, with this by to the detection of the refrigeration of each chamber and the complete machine operation conditions that the cooling situation is judged refrigerator.
Further, after the refrigeration for refrigerator test was finished, the control refrigerator entered normal mode of operation, and normal mode of operation is the normal control stage of refrigerator.In this example, the mode that the control refrigerator enters normal mode of operation can make refrigerator switch back normal mode of operation by the mode of Pen-down detection switch again, perhaps, controller is automatically controlled refrigerator and is returned normal mode of operation after judging that the refrigeration detection reaches Preset Time.
Step S104 is according to the performance test results of switch testing result and refrigeration test result generation refrigerator.For example show the whether normal of load and load circuit among the switch testing result, the cryogenic temperature that reaches of the refrigeration test of each chamber of display refrigerator for example in the refrigeration test result.Thus, analyze by the cryogenic temperature of cryogenic temperature and expection and whether the switching of load is satisfied above-mentioned switch testing rule and can be judged whether refrigerator is up to standard.For example, suppose that the reefer Current Temperatures is 20 degrees centigrade, according to the specification of refrigerator, suppose to freeze in theory 10 minutes after temperature of refrigerating chamber be 10 degrees centigrade, then according to the temperature of the reefer of reality and in theory the temperature of reefer refrigeration after 10 minutes judge whether the refrigeration performance of refrigerator up to standard.
According to the detection method of refrigerator of the present invention, can be accurately and efficient whether low to detect each road load of refrigerator normal and whether the refrigeration for refrigerator performance is up to standard.

Need to prove, be provided with detecting pattern and normal mode of operation in the controller of the refrigerator of embodiments of the invention.
As shown in Figure 3, the treatment step of the detection of the refrigerator of the detection method of refrigerator under detecting pattern comprises according to an embodiment of the invention:
Step S301 enters or withdraws from detecting pattern by aobvious plate button (i.e. detector switch on the aobvious control plate).
Enter or withdraw from detecting pattern by the detector switch that triggers on the aobvious plate.If when being in normal mode, then enter detecting pattern by detector switch.If when being in detecting pattern, then withdraw from detecting pattern by detector switch.Thus, the detection method of the refrigerator that the embodiment of the invention provides can realize carrying out the switching of detecting pattern and normal mode of operation in the situation that do not cut off the power supply.
In order to prevent client's maloperation, in a preferred example of the present invention, use the non routine operation method, detector switch is set to Macintosh, and in refrigerator starts 1 minute, continue button and can think above 5 seconds effectively, wherein, Macintosh can be two (or three) buttons, and the time interval of button is less than 200ms.Be understandable that, select normal mode or detecting pattern to be not limited to the mode of combination button, can also be other implementations.
Step S302 detects mark position 1, normal zone bit zero clearing, and pass to master control borad as communication data.In an example of the present invention, the controller of refrigerator (master control borad) is set in steering logic by the zone bit that detecting pattern is set and the zone bit of normal mode and is judged whether to enter detecting pattern.If when being in detecting pattern, detecting zone bit is 1, and normal zone bit is 0; During normal mode of operation, detecting zone bit is 0, normal mark position 1.Zone bit is passed to controller as communication data simultaneously.Wherein, communication data comprises detection instruction and normal instruction.Namely detect instruction for detect zone bit be 1 and normal zone bit be 0, normal instruction for detect zone bit be 0 and normal zone bit be 1.
Step S303, controller (master control borad) judges, and whether carries out detecting pattern.Particularly, master control borad gathers up-to-date control data by real-time and aobvious control board communications.If master control borad receives when detecting instruction, and meet entry condition then master control borad enter detecting pattern, otherwise, then enter normal mode of operation.
Step S304 satisfies condition, and carries out relevant control.
If satisfy terms and conditions, carry out trace routine, load and loop are detected.Phase one is implemented intelligent fast detecting to each road load, after all loads and loop detection are complete, enter subordinate phase each chamber refrigeration performance of refrigerator is detected, and can judge refrigerator complete machine operation conditions by check refrigeration and cooling situation.
Step S305 does not meet and automatically changes normal mode over to after entry condition or test process finish.Particularly, control finishes or is ineligible, and system can change normal control model over to from test pattern automatically.
Embodiments of the invention make production line finish refrigerator short time, comprehensive detection by allowing refrigerator checking line independent operating detecting pattern steering logic by setting up detecting pattern to enter and exit criteria, realize efficient, intelligent check and detection.When setting up the service condition of detecting pattern, take into full account client's use habit simultaneously, enter detecting pattern by Macintosh, avoid occuring because client's maloperation causes the disorderly situation of refrigerator system operation.Simultaneously, provide the detection logic of detecting pattern to withdraw from outlet, allow refrigerator automatically move still can to change normal mode of operation over to after the trace routine and normally control.
According to the detection method of the refrigerator of the embodiment of the invention, by the switch testing to load, whether normally can detect load circuit, and after switch testing was finished, by test that refrigerator is freezed, whether the refrigeration that can detect refrigerator was up to standard, like this.Can realize the whether dual test of normal and refrigerator performance of refrigerator load (load circuit), can Effective Raise detect whether normal and refrigerator performance accuracy up to standard and detect consuming time short whether of refrigerator load, in addition, the standardization of the method testing process, be beneficial to and popularize, realize refrigerator short time, the automatic detection that comprehensive and accuracy is high, thereby promote the quality of refrigerator.
By the detection method of the embodiment of the invention, in testing experiment, to test a refrigerator and can shorten to 20-40 minute by traditional 1 hour, and can find a lot of potential risks, detection efficiency is high, thereby has guaranteed well the quality of dispatching from the factory of product.
